About Woodrow

Woodrow is a residential area located in Worcestershire, England, within the B98 postcode area. It is situated close to the town of Redditch, providing access to various amenities and services. The area features a mix of housing, including modern developments and older properties, catering to a diverse community. Local facilities include schools, parks, and shops, making it a convenient place for families and individuals alike. The surrounding countryside offers opportunities for outdoor activities, while the nearby town centre of Redditch provides additional shopping and dining options. Woodrow is well-connected by road and public transport, allowing for easy travel to nearby towns and cities.

School Ratings in Woodrow

Families in Woodrow have access to 55 local schools. Holly Trees Children's Centre, Woodlands Children's Centre and Arrow Vale High School are each rated Outstanding by Ofsted. A further 18 schools hold a Good rating.

Crime and Anti-Social Behaviour in Woodrow

Crime in the area is higher than the national average. Shoplifting is the leading concern across Woodrow, with 48 incidents recorded in April 2026.

Crime in Woodrow 401 crimes · April 2026

High Crime Area

Crime figures for Woodrow are higher than the England and Wales average, with violence & sexual offences the most prevalent offence recorded. Urban density and footfall contribute to elevated reporting in areas like this. Ongoing investment in policing and community safety programmes aims to improve the picture.
